diff options
author | J0WI <J0WI@users.noreply.github.com> | 2020-10-04 02:58:15 +0200 |
---|---|---|
committer | Leo <thinkabit.ukim@gmail.com> | 2020-10-04 07:25:37 +0000 |
commit | a0a751637d466e80d44af3fa7811d0f69fe9df91 (patch) | |
tree | 8efa94c01090a87a64180633ca6d456121dec635 /testing/lua-middleclass/APKBUILD | |
parent | 6d2848b0016d85f69ae0ec8efac22736dd28e6e8 (diff) |
testing/lua-middleclass: upgrade to 4.1.1
Diffstat (limited to 'testing/lua-middleclass/APKBUILD')
-rw-r--r-- | testing/lua-middleclass/APKBUILD | 29 |
1 files changed, 10 insertions, 19 deletions
diff --git a/testing/lua-middleclass/APKBUILD b/testing/lua-middleclass/APKBUILD index 296a68faeec..bb5808c7cd0 100644 --- a/testing/lua-middleclass/APKBUILD +++ b/testing/lua-middleclass/APKBUILD @@ -1,42 +1,33 @@ # Contributor: Carlo Landmeter <clandmeter@gmail.com> # Maintainer: pkgname=lua-middleclass -pkgver=4.0.0 +pkgver=4.1.1 pkgrel=0 _luaversions="5.1 5.2 5.3" pkgdesc="Object-orientation for Lua" url="https://github.com/kikito/middleclass" arch="noarch" license="MIT" -depends="" -depends_dev="" makedepends="$depends_dev" -install="" -subpackages="" -source="middleclass-$pkgver.tar.gz::https://github.com/kikito/middleclass/archive/v$pkgver.tar.gz" +source="$pkgname-$pkgver.tar.gz::https://github.com/kikito/middleclass/archive/v$pkgver.tar.gz" +builddir="$srcdir/middleclass-$pkgver" for _v in $_luaversions; do subpackages="$subpackages lua$_v-${pkgname#*lua-}:split_${_v/./_}" eval "split_${_v/./_}() { _split $_v; }" done -builddir="$srcdir"/middleclass-$pkgver - -build() { - return 0 -} - package() { mkdir -p "$pkgdir" } _split() { - cd "$builddir" - local _ver="$1" - install_if="lua$_ver $pkgname=$pkgver-r$pkgrel" - pkgdesc="Object-orientation for Lua $_ver" - install -Dm644 middleclass.lua \ - "$subpkgdir/usr/share/lua/$_ver/middleclass.lua" || return 1 + cd "$builddir" + local _ver="$1" + install_if="lua$_ver $pkgname=$pkgver-r$pkgrel" + pkgdesc="Object-orientation for Lua $_ver" + install -Dm644 middleclass.lua \ + "$subpkgdir/usr/share/lua/$_ver/middleclass.lua" } -sha512sums="c648bd3fd9bc2e3edf802c04734b1e940311cc7a1556c51336047a52ae2b0fa7d107f3c8509ffb51cce49e865e9a6e22f4cd53f6e50255d26819060159d228a2 middleclass-4.0.0.tar.gz" +sha512sums="d408435752adf4309a444e1d573ece1d8c79f20dde91f01d7724399079f19a4bfb99083d8cdc70eeb3c1aa21971c272df88cd4c2cce0eb942857de42e4a887e3 lua-middleclass-4.1.1.tar.gz" |